<p>TORONTO, ON – <strong>JUNO award-winning R&B singer-songwriter</strong> <a contents="Sean Jones"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="http://www.seanjonesmusic.com/"><span style="color:#ffcccc;"><strong>Sean Jones</strong></span></a> is back with a brand-new album titled <a contents="Weekend Lover"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://music.apple.com/ca/artist/sean-jones/438745452"><span style="color:#e74c3c;"><strong>Weekend Lover</strong></span></a>. The album features a set of songs that are reminiscent of 90’s R&B and will be released November 5 via all streaming platforms. </p>
<p>Produced by <strong>Murray Daigle</strong> (Keshia Chante, Serena Ryder, BRDGS), the album has something for everyone with its mix of fast and mid-tempo tracks and just the right amount of awesome slow jams added to the mix. <a contents="Love Will"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>Love Will</strong></span></a>, a bass-heavy mixture of classic house and 90’s R&B, written by Jones, Daigle, and Adrian X, was the first release from the album and speaks to the theme of love in a real and honest way. </p>
<p><em>“I am so excited about this record. This album is a coming home of sorts for me. While I have truly enjoyed creating and performing music in multiple genres over the years, 90's R&B has always been my first love. This record is just an extension of my heart. There is no filler. Every song is special and unique in its own way. And the tunes will undoubtedly take you back in time. Murray and I made sure to add in just enough modern-day elements to keep this fresh and in line with the sound of music today. I am super proud of this body of work. If you are a lover of 90's R&B I can most certainly guarantee that you will not be disappointed.” </em> </p>
<p>Opening with the album's title track, listeners are immediately transported to a nostalgic scene of young lust and seduction. “<a contents="Weekend Lover"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>Weekend Lover</strong></span></a>” is a throwback anthem that sets the album’s tone, bringing it back to Sean’s roller-skating days. “<a contents="Drink"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>Drink</strong></span></a>” is an infectious earworm and this entrancing track flutters through the materialistic wonders of life, and lands on the remaining fact that staying grounded in what is really important - the human connection - is the key to living a meaningful life. </p>
<p><strong><a contents="Weekend Lover"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://music.apple.com/ca/artist/sean-jones/438745452"><span style="color:#e74c3c;">Weekend Lover</span></a> </strong>has been in the works for quite some time, a fact that is especially evident with “<a contents="Hooked"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>Hooked</strong></span></a>”, the song marking the halfway point of the album, featuring a rhythmic guitar progression that was written by Sean back in 2010. It took just over a decade for Sean to find the right melody and lyrics to accompany the track, preciseness that is indicative of the singer-songwriter’s dedication to his craft. </p>
<p>In 2015, Sean became the first artist to secure a solo summer residency at the historic <a contents="Casa Loma"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://casaloma.ca/"><span style="color:#3498db;"><strong>Casa Loma</strong></span></a> in downtown Toronto. The Monday night revue titled <strong>Soul in The City</strong> gave Jones and his nine-piece band, <a contents="The Righteous Echo"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>The Righteous Echo</strong></span></a>, the chance to showcase his original songs as well as their take on popular old-school R&B and soul hits. The show would also give emerging artists a stage to share their talents. </p>
<p>The night's overwhelming success led to<strong> WestJet</strong>, Canada’s second-largest airline, handpicking Sean to create a musical experience for the passengers aboard their flights. For the project titled, <strong>The WestJet Boarding Sessions</strong>, Jones recorded new versions of classic Canadian hits such as <a contents="These Eyes"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>These Eyes</strong></span></a> by <strong>The Guess Who</strong>, <a contents="The Weight&nbsp;by The Band"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>The Weight by The Band</strong></span></a>, and <a contents="Angel" data-link-label="" data-link-type="url" href="https://open.spotify.com/album/0ekCxxh06VT7nax0XGdYLB?si=UnY14OnhShiFGas0dhUJaw&nd=1"><span style="color:#1abc9c;"><strong>Angel</strong></span></a> by <strong>Sarah McLachlan</strong> and flew across Canada to interview some of these cherished musical icons. </p>
<p><em>“Growing up, my parents played all the classics, Temptations, Marvin Gaye, Otis Redding, The Supremes... the list goes on and on. I loved all of it then and to this day. However, the music of the late ‘80s and ‘90s is what sparked my interest in performing. There was something about the musical energy of that time. The R&B/Pop songs were infectious and well written. I was truly missing that vibe and started writing songs in that vein. It’s taken a couple of years to finish, but I’m excited to start sharing it with everyone.” </em> </p>

<p>Born in Los Angeles, Celeste moved to England with her mom when she was three. In a conversation with Interview Magazine, Celeste reveals that her singing prowess was identified an early age. At nine, Celeste was offered a scholarship to practice singing at a performing arts school, although she only attended for one year. Still, Celeste maintains that she always wanted to have a career in music.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><span class="font_large"><strong>''Strange''</strong></span></p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><iframe class="justify_inline" data-video-type="youtube" data-video-id="A1AJEv50Ld4" data-video-thumb-url="https://img.youtube.com/vi/A1AJEv50Ld4/mqdefault.jpg" type="text/html"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/A1AJEv50Ld4?rel=0&wmode=transparent&enablejsapi=1" frameborder="0" height="180" width="320" allowfullscreen="true"></iframe></p>
<p>When she was 16, Celeste uploaded a song on YouTube. It got the attention of a prospective manager, who eventually ended up arranging studio sessions for Celeste at the infamous Sarm West Studios in Notting Hill, London. Several legendary artists have used the studio to song write and record. That includes the likes of Led Zeppelin, The Clash, Rihanna, and Paul McCartney. According to Dummy Magazine, the people who ran the studio were so impressed with Celeste’s songwriting that they kept giving her more time there.</p>
<p>Celeste’s career took off from there. She released various songs over the next few years, including the single “Daydreaming.” The song is consistent with Celeste’s body of work, with sweet, soaring vocals over a laid-back instrumental. According toi-D Magazine, the song was written while Celeste was working at a local pub. Celeste says that she was “pulling pints” while imagining she was performing in the infamous Carnegie Hall in New York City. If that “daydream” became a reality in the near future, we wouldn’t be surprised. Check out a riveting live performance of the song here:</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><iframe class="justify_inline" data-video-type="youtube" data-video-id="lLvIPlUnrf4" data-video-thumb-url="https://img.youtube.com/vi/lLvIPlUnrf4/mqdefault.jpg" type="text/html"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/lLvIPlUnrf4?rel=0&wmode=transparent&enablejsapi=1" frameborder="0" height="180" width="320" allowfullscreen="true"></iframe></p>
<p>Celeste’s family played an important role in developing her musical influences. Her grandparents exposed her to classic singers like Aretha Franklin and Ella Fitzgerald at a very early age. In her interview with i-D, Celeste reveals that the first album she ever listened to front-to-back was an Aretha Franklin tape. Her grandad used to play the tape while driving Celeste around in his cherry red Jaguar. Celeste remembers those moments fondly, saying that her face “lit up” upon hearing Aretha Franklin’s voice for the first time. </p>
<p>In a slightly unexpected way, Celeste’s father, who had remained in California when she moved, also influenced her. A few years after his untimely death, Celeste discovered a wardrobe full of his vinyl records while rummaging through his room in Los Angeles. She brought the records home with her, and used them to discover new music and search for possible samples.</p>
<p>As for more modern inspirations, Celeste mentions Frank Ocean, Solange, and Kanye West as some of the musicians she emulates. Celeste also lists Kanye as one of the artists with whom she would most like to collaborate. She’s a huge fan of Kanye’s classic album “My Beautiful Dark Twisted Fantasy.” When she was 18, Celeste says that she listened to the critically-acclaimed record three times a night. She enjoyed the fact that the music felt “free and experimental,” but could also be played “at a bus or at a party”. We could say the same about her music!</p>
<p>When talking to Interview Magazine about her writing and recording process, Celeste says that she often spends time listening to music that inspires her beforehand. She then goes to the studio and begins to develop melodies with one or two piano players. Celeste explains that sometimes the songwriting process can be strenuous and time-consuming. Other times, the songwriting process is quick. An example is her song “Chocolate,” which was nearly complete within 10 minutes of first hearing the instrumental. <p>30 JUNE 2020, (TORONTO, ON) - Riding high off her Best Director win at the BET Awards, Tenaya Taylor captures the second #1 debut of her career today, as The Album takes the #1 spot on the Billboard R&B/Hip-Hop Albums chart. The Album enters the Top 10 on the Billboard 200 Albums chart at #8, the highest debut of Teyana’s career. </p>
<p>The strong critical and commercial reception for The Album is a sweet coda to Teyana’s special announcement two weeks ago of her and husband Iman’s pregnancy with their second child. Teyana revealed the news in her new video for "Wake Up Love" (premiered June 12th) featuring Iman, daughter Junie and their special guest. </p>
<p>With features from Erykah Badu, Missy Elliott, Future, Ms. Lauryn Hill, Quavo, Rick Ross, Big Sean, and others, THE ALBUM was tapped by Pitchfork as one of the “most anticipated albums of the summer.” In addition to "Wake Up Love," Teyana’s masterpiece includes her new graduation anthem "Made It,"pegged by NPR as a “a triumphant, isolation-proof anthem for the Class of 2020,” as well as the Janet Jackson-approved viral sensation "Bare Wit Me," the Kanye West-produced "We Got Love" featuring Ms. Lauryn Hill, and "How You Want It? (HYWI?)" featuring King Combs. </p>
<p>The Album is the highly anticipated successor to K.T.S.E. (June 2018), Teyana’s second album, one of the five G.O.O.D. Music/Def Jam albums produced by Kanye West during his 2018 sojourn in Jackson Hole, Wyoming. K.T.S.E. (acronym for Keep That Same Energy) set off an 18-month chain reaction for Teyana, starting with its summertime Top 10 R&B smash “Gonna Love Me.” She performed “Gonna Love Me” (in a medley with “Rose In Harlem,” another K.T.S.E.track) on The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on. Hip-hop audiences embraced the "Gonna Love Me" remix featuring Wu-Tang Clan’s Ghostface Killah, Method Man and Raekwon, whose video was directed by Teyana. </p>
<p>K.T.S.E. spun off a hot new single and video for Teyana in early 2019, the explicit "WTP (Work This P***y)." The video was nominated for “Best Dance Performance” at the 32nd annual BET Soul Train Awards. The third single from K.T.S.E. was the evocative "Issues/Hold On." After slaying the audience with the song live on Ellen in April 2019, Teyana was surprised on-air when Ellen presented her with the RIAA gold award plaque for “Gonna Love Me,” bringing it all full circle. </p>
<p>Since the release of K.T.S.E., Teyana’s star has continued to rise; from her successful career as video director and continued investment in her production company, The Aunties, to her acting and modeling career, to a string of scintillating self-directed singles and videos, including “Morning” with Kehlani. The Album is poised to take Teyana to the next level. </p>
<p><strong>About TEYANA TAYLOR</strong>: </p>
<p>Being a jack of trades has enabled Teyana Taylor to become a master of all. From her smoky melodic vocals to her dynamic dance moves, the R&B superstar entertainer dips in dives between her talents as singer, songwriter, producer, director, dancer/choreographer, actor, fitness guru, model, and mother. When it comes to describing herself, the Harlem native can only think of one word: Everything. </p>
<p>“I literally can do everything. I never look at anything as being impossible,” she explains. “I exhaust all options to make what happen when I need to make happen.” Her mantra made her an early favorite to artists like Pharrell, who she signed her first deal with, and later choreographed videos for artists like Beyoncé and Jay-Z. In 2014, Teyana’s love for the arts and R&B earned her the title of the first woman signed to Kanye West’s G.O.O.D. Music imprint. </p>
<p>Between R&B’s identity crisis in the 2010s, Teyana dropped her debut album VII in November 2014, which included “Maybe” (featuring Yo Gotti and Pusha T) and the sultry “Just Different” shaping her musical persona. The critically acclaimed album debuted at #1 on the Billboard Top R&B/Hip-Hop Albums chart in 2014, cementing her position in today’s modern R&B field. “I fought for that raw, hood necessary R&B and now I feel like it's better than ever,” she says. </p>
<p>After spicing up the R&B charts, Teyana was blessed with the arrival of her daughter Junie with husband and NBA star Iman Shumpert in 2015. “I do all of this for my baby. She's who I do it for,” she says about Iman “Junie” Tayla Shumpert Jr., her main source of inspiration. “I always show her how to be a leader and a businesswoman. I want her to believe that she can be anything she wants to be and it not be a shocker that she's a female doing it all.” Soon after, Teyana went on to star in the internet-breaking video for Kanye West’s “Fade,” and scored her first MTV Moonman for “Best Choreography” at the 2017 MTV Video Music Awards. </p>
<p>But it wasn’t until the release of her second album project K.T.S.E. (released June 2018) that the world caught up with Teyana’s talents. With her all-female production company The Aunties, Teyana self-directed videos for “WTP,” the RIAA gold-selling single “Gonna Love Me,” (whose remix features Wu-Tang Clan’s Ghostface Killah, Method Man and Raekwon), and recently, “Issues/Hold On.” Teyana has also directed videos for her peers like T.I. (“You”), Monica (“Commitment”), and Lil Duval (“Pull Up” featuring Ty Dolla $ign) with fans like Ms. Lauryn Hill and Elton John praising her boss moves. </p>
<p>Part of what makes Teyana stand out from the rest is her ability to move with precision and poise in everything she does. From the studio to the stage, every idea is a project with the singer front and center with a vision all her own. With her musical inspirations like Aaliyah, Teena Marie, Mint Condition and Janet Jackson speaking to her soul, Teyana is aware her mission is larger than life. “I’m working on me every day and I think that’s my purpose,” she says, comparing her life to a never-ending book. “I’m still going, still mastering and being a better me.” </p>

<p>Bill Withers, who wrote and sang a string of soulful songs in the 1970s that have stood the test of time, including “ Lean on Me, ” “Lovely Day” and “Ain’t No Sunshine,” has died from heart complications, his family said in a statement to The Associated Press. He was 81. </p>
<p>The three-time Grammy Award winner, who withdrew from making music in the mid-1980s, died on Monday in Los Angeles, the statement said. His death comes as the public has drawn inspiration from his music during the coronavirus pandemic, with health care workers, choirs, artists and more posting their own renditions on “Lean on Me” to help get through the difficult times.</p>
<p>“We are devastated by the loss of our beloved, devoted husband and father. A solitary man with a heart driven to connect to the world at large, with his poetry and music, he spoke honestly to people and connected them to each other,” the family statement read. “As private a life as he lived close to intimate family and friends, his music forever belongs to the world. In this difficult time, we pray his music offers comfort and entertainment as fans hold tight to loved ones.”</p>
<p>Withers’ songs during his brief career have become the soundtracks of countless engagements, weddings and backyard parties. They have powerful melodies and perfect grooves melded with a smooth voice that conveys honesty and complex emotions without vocal acrobatics. </p>
<p>“Lean on Me,” a paean to friendship, was performed at the inaugurations of both Barack Obama and Bill Clinton. “Ain’t No Sunshine”and “Lean on Me” are among Rolling Stone’s list of the 500 Greatest Songs of All Time. </p>
<p>“He’s the last African-American Everyman,” musician and band leader Questlove told Rolling Stone in 2015. “Bill Withers is the closest thing black people have to a Bruce Springsteen.” </p>
<p>His death caused a torrent of appreciation on social media, including from former Obama adviser Valerie Jarrett, who said Withers’ music has been a cherished part of her life. “It added to my joy in the good times, and also gave me comfort and inspiration when I needed it most,” she tweeted.</p>
<p>Billy Dee Williams tweeted “your music cheered my heart and soothed my soul” and Chance the Rapper said Withers’ songs are “some of the best songs of all time” and “my heart really hurts for him.” Lenny Kravitz said “My soul always has and always will be full of your music.” </p>
<p>“We lost a giant of songwriting today,” ASCAP President and Chairman Paul Williams said in a statement. “Bill Withers’ songs are among the most treasured and profound in the American songbook — universal in the way they touch people all over the world, transcending genre and generation. He was a beautiful man with a stunning sense of humor and a gift for truth.” </p>
<p>Withers, who overcame a childhood stutter, was born the last of six children in the coal mining town of Slab Fork, West Virginia. After his parents divorced when he was 3, Withers was raised by his mother’s family in nearby Beckley. </p>
<p>He joined the Navy at 17 and spent nine years in the service as an aircraft mechanic installing toilets. After his discharge, he moved to Los Angeles, worked at an aircraft parts factory, bought a guitar at a pawn shop and recorded demos of his tunes in hopes of landing a recording contract. </p>
<p>In 1971, signed to Sussex Records, he put out his first album, “Just As I Am,” with the legendary Booker T. Jones at the helm. It had the hits “Grandma’s Hands” and “Ain’t No Sunshine,” which was inspired by the Jack Lemmon film “Days of Wine and Roses.” He was photographed on the cover, smiling and holding his lunch pail. </p>
<p>“Ain’t No Sunshine” was originally released as the B-side of his debut single, “Harlem.” But radio DJs flipped the disc and the song climbed to No. 3 on the Billboard charts and spent a total of 16 weeks in the top 40. </p>
<p>Withers went on to generate more hits a year later with the inspirational “Lean on Me,” the menacing “Who Is He (and What Is He to You)” and the slinky “Use Me” on his second album, “Still Bill.”</p>

<p>Rhythm and blues artist Carlos Morgan's first audiences were from the Church of God of Prophecy in his native Canada. When he was a teen he moved on to perform with a number of R&B groups before going solo. His musical career has been one as a singer, songwriter, session artist, and even producer. After his first album was released in the '90s, he earned a number of awards, including a Canadian Urban Music Award for Best R&B Male Vocalist, a Juno Award for Best R&B/Soul Recording, and a MuchMusic Video Award for Best R&B Video. </p>
<p>Carlos Morgan grew up listening to artists like Nat "King" Cole and Stevie Wonder. Morgan's taste for music was versatile, moving freely between gospel, jazz, pop, rock, and even classical. A couple of the early R&B groups he worked with were Blue Zone and Lypstick. </p>
<p>In 1996, Morgan completed his debut album, Feelin' Alright. The recording was released under the D-Tone Records label -- a record label that Morgan formed with two friends. The independent album sold well, and music reviewers took notice; so did Universal Music Canada. Feelin' Alright was soon released again, this time under the Universal label. Some of the tracks on the debut are "Give It to Me," "Baby C'mon," "Whatcha Got," "Forever for You," and "April Flower." </p>

<p>His rough voice and its melancholy ache were the vocal equivalent of a furrowed brow; his breezy, surprisingly lo-fi music provided a mix of ’80s synth-soul and blissful beats. Khalid’s debut album, 2017’s “American Teen,” was an exquisite vision of the same “quiet storm” Smokey Robinson sang about in 1975. Replace Smokey’s pillow talk with Khalid’s obsession with immediate connection, Internet camaraderie, cellphone photo albums and Uber hookups, then add in the folly, frolic and fragility of what it means to be a teen, and you got a modern, multi-platinum artist hinting at the past but racing into the future.</p>
<p>A gifted artist with a searching voice that can suggest a stoner Sam Cooke, Khalid further developed his pop chops on last year’s Suncity EP, nodding to reggaeton and Coldplay-esque melody. That wide-ranging talent is on display all over his second LP. The best moments recall American Teen’s airy feel and warm charisma. “Talk,” produced by U.K. house duo -Disclosure, is a gorgeously bloopy synth-soul strut; on “Right Back,” Khalid extends an invitation to hang at the beach, over a sparkling track that smoothly interpolates Big Pun’s Nineties classic “Still Not a Player.”</p>
<p>The credits to Free Spirit include Norse hitmakers Stargate, and Portugal. The Man producer John Hill. Yet despite some noteworthy cameos — John Mayer on the feathery disco tune “Outta My Head,” Father John Misty assisting on production for the maudlin “Heaven” — the LP isn’t overly burdened by the bold-faced guest spots you’d expect on a follow-up by an artist coming off a Top 10 debut. Instead, it gets tripped up by a different sophomore pitfall: Now that he isn’t an underdog, Khalid lapses into a little too much new-star introspection, exploring an ivory-tower aloneness that can recall the Weeknd’s goth-‘n’-B. On “My Bad,” he tries to stir some drama out of missing your texts because he was working too late at the studio, with nothing to ease his angst but some limpid George Benson guitar flicks. Elsewhere, why-me reflections like “Alive” and “Hundred” feel like solo late-night Uber rides into the dark heart of the soul. </p>
<p>The self-examining gloom gets thicker as the record proceeds. But Khalid remains a sympathetic guy; see “Self,”where he shifts from bluesy grumble to flighty falsetto as he observes, “My raw emotion make me less of a man?” turning self-doubt into a critique of phony masculinity.</p>
<p>That openness also comes through on the bonus track “Saturday Nights,” also on Suncity; Khalid’s voice vaults beautifully as he sings to a girl with a rough home life and a job she hates. It’s a sweet song with a classic message: Growing up is hard to do. Free Spirit reminds us just how weird it can be.</p>

<p>Known for bringing hip-hop energy into electro-funk and R&B, lophiile (real name: Tyler Acord) made a name for himself as a go-to producer for breaking artists. Now, he's showing fans a fuller portrait of his diverse musical vision with a debut EP on Blue Note Records. Titled To Forgive, it's a forward-thinking, open-minded portrait of contemporary jazz. </p>
<p>Born into a deeply musical family - his mother was a gospel singer and his father was a trumpet player and sound engineer - Acord had early introductions to Motown and soul, from classics like Stevie Wonder and Marvin Gaye to contemporary artists like Jill Scott and India Arie. He fell in love with hip-hop as a teenager, studied jazz in college, and spent three years touring with his twin brother's hardcore band, Issues, as their drummer/keyboardist and traveling DJ. But his dream was always to make his own music. In 2015, he returned to Los Angeles and wrote and produced for some of indie and electronic music's most promising artists: GoldLink, H.E.R., Gallant, Ray Blk, Moss Kena, Nick Grant, Freddie Gibbs, Skrillex and Zedd. It was through these sessions that he met Marco Bernardis and Fabienne Holloway, two London musicians who shared his vision for jazz as the ultimate musical hybrid. Together, they formed Radiant Children, a contemporary R&B band that uses slick electronics, imaginative samples, and live instrumentation to breathe new life into funk and soul. </p>
<p>In 2018, Acord relocated to London full-time. It was there that he put the finishing touches on To Forgive (out February 21), a thorough, thoughtful commentary on the duality of forgiveness: rage and release, bitterness and love, darkness and light. His single, "You've Changed", is a mesmerizing journey of jazz motifs, hip-hop rhythms, chopped-up vocal samples and soulful piano. It's a perfect introduction to his musical vision in which instrumentation and flow are front and centre. "lophiile represents the search for my sound, my independence," he says. "It's who I am as an artist."</p>
